[New-bugs-announce] [issue42787] email.utils.getaddresses improper parsing of unicode realnames
Konstantin Ryabitsev
report at bugs.python.org
Wed Dec 30 11:01:25 EST 2020
New submission from Konstantin Ryabitsev <konstantin at linuxfoundation.org>:
What it currently does:
>>> import email.utils
>>> email.utils.getaddresses(['Shuming [范書銘] <shumingf at realtek.com>'])
[('', 'Shuming'), ('', ''), ('', '范書銘'), ('', ''), ('', 'shumingf at realtek.com')]
What it should do:
>>> import email.utils
>>> email.utils.getaddresses(['Shuming [范書銘] <shumingf at realtek.com>'])
[('Shuming [范書銘]'), 'shumingf at realtek.com')]
----------
components: email
messages: 384069
nosy: barry, konstantin2, r.david.murray
priority: normal
severity: normal
status: open
title: email.utils.getaddresses improper parsing of unicode realnames
type: enhancement
versions: Python 3.9
_______________________________________
Python tracker <report at bugs.python.org>
<https://bugs.python.org/issue42787>
_______________________________________
More information about the New-bugs-announce
mailing list